2. Which Areas In Ecuador Should I Avoid?
Some areas in Ecuador should be avoided due to high crime rates. The U.S. Department of State advises against travel to specific locations, including certain parts of Guayaquil, and cities in the provinces of El Oro, Los Rios, and Esmeraldas. SIXT.VN recommends avoiding these areas to ensure your safety and well-being.
Here’s a more detailed breakdown of areas to avoid:
- Guayaquil (south of Portete de Tarqui Avenue): High crime rates make this area particularly dangerous.
- Huaquillas and Arenillas (El Oro province): Crime is a significant concern in these cities.
- Quevedo, Quinsaloma, and Pueblo Viejo (Los Rios province): These cities also experience high levels of criminal activity.
- Duran (Guayas province): The canton of Duran is known for its high crime rate.
- Esmeraldas city and areas north of it (Esmeraldas province): This region has a high incidence of crime.
It’s essential to heed these warnings and plan your travel itinerary accordingly.
3. Which Areas In Ecuador Should I Reconsider Traveling To?
Certain areas in Ecuador require travelers to reconsider their plans due to safety concerns. This includes Guayaquil (north of Portete de Tarqui Avenue) and provinces like El Oro, Los Rios, Esmeraldas, Sucumbios, Manabi, Santa Elena, and Santo Domingo. SIXT.VN advises exercising extreme caution if you must travel to these regions.
Expanding on areas where travel should be reconsidered:
- Guayaquil (north of Portete de Tarqui Avenue): Exercise increased vigilance due to crime.
- El Oro province (outside Huaquillas and Arenillas): Be cautious when traveling outside the main cities.
- Los Rios province (outside Quevedo, Quinsaloma, and Pueblo Viejo): Remain vigilant when traveling outside the named cities due to potential crime.
- Areas south of Esmeraldas city (Esmeraldas province): Exercise caution in these areas due to ongoing criminal activity.
- Provinces of Sucumbios, Manabi, Santa Elena, and Santo Domingo: These provinces have seen increased criminal activity.
Prioritize your safety by being informed and prepared when visiting these areas.

6. What Are The Land Border Restrictions For Entering Ecuador?
Foreign citizens entering Ecuador via land borders from Colombia or Peru must present an apostilled certificate showing no criminal record. SIXT.VN advises travelers to comply with this requirement to avoid entry issues.
Details on land border restrictions:
- Required Documentation: An apostilled certificate showing a lack of criminal record is mandatory.
- Where to Obtain: Information is available on the Ministry of Tourism’s webpage and Ecuador.Travel.
- U.S. Citizens: U.S. citizens should consult Travel.State.Gov for information on obtaining a criminal record check and apostille from the United States.
Ensure you have the necessary documentation to facilitate a smooth border crossing.

12. How Does Civil Unrest Affect Travel In Ecuador?
Civil unrest in Ecuador can significantly affect travel plans. Demonstrations and protests often lead to road closures, transportation disruptions, and potential safety risks. SIXT.VN recommends monitoring local news and avoiding areas where unrest is occurring.
Impacts of civil unrest on travel:
- Road Closures: Demonstrators routinely block roads and highways.
- Transportation Disruptions: Public transportation may be suspended or delayed.
- Safety Risks: Protests can sometimes turn violent, posing a risk to travelers.
Stay informed and plan your travel accordingly to minimize disruptions.

21. What Are Some Common Scams To Watch Out For In Ecuador?
Common scams to watch out for in Ecuador include overcharging, fake police officers, and pickpocketing. Be aware of your surroundings and avoid displaying wealth. SIXT.VN advises travelers to be vigilant and cautious.
Common scams:
- Overcharging: Be wary of inflated prices for goods and services.
- Fake Police Officers: Be cautious of individuals posing as police officers.
- Pickpocketing: Keep your belongings secure and be aware of your surroundings.
- ATM Scams: Use ATMs in secure locations and protect your PIN.
- Taxi Scams: Ensure the taxi meter is running or negotiate the fare beforehand.
Staying vigilant and informed can help you avoid becoming a victim of scams.

37. What Are The Potential Health Risks And How Can I Prepare For Them?
Potential health risks in Ecuador include altitude sickness, mosquito-borne diseases, and food and waterborne illnesses. Prepare by consulting your doctor, getting necessary vaccinations, and practicing safe food and water habits. SIXT.VN advises travelers to take these health precautions.
Health risk preparation:
- Consult Your Doctor: Discuss your travel plans and potential health risks with your doctor.
- Get Vaccinations: Obtain recommended vaccinations for Ecuador.
- Altitude Sickness: Take precautions to prevent and manage altitude sickness.
- Mosquito-Borne Diseases: Use insect repellent and wear protective clothing.
- Food and Water Safety: Drink bottled water and eat at reputable establishments.
Taking these health precautions can help you stay healthy and safe during your trip to Ecuador.
